B3 Deforestation

?
what is biodiversity?
range of different living organisms in a habitat
1 of 9
when does deforestation occur?
when trees are harvested unsustainably
2 of 9
what does deforestionation release into the atmosphere?
CO2 as carbon locked in the trees is burnt and released & methane
3 of 9
what is biofuel?
fuels such as wood, ethanol or biodiesel - obtained from living plants or animals
4 of 9
what's another reason for increased levels CO2 in the atmosphere other than the carbon locked in trees?
a decrease in photosynthesis which captures carbon
5 of 9
whas an example of unsustainable harvesting ?
when trees are cut and their roots are burnt (slash and burn)
6 of 9
what's biodiesel?
fuel made from plant oils such as rapeseed
7 of 9
why has deforestation occurred?
so crops can be planted to use for food, biofuels or for livestock
8 of 9
what as increased of methane in the atmosphere?
cattle and rice paddies
